Job description

JOB TITLE: Information Technology Support Professional

EMPLOYMENT TYPE: Full-time, 40 hours/wk

SCHEDULED HOURS: Monday-Friday, 8:00AM-4:30PM

PROGRAM/LOCATION: Information Technology, Windsor, CT

PC#: 2735

ABOUT THE POSITION

To provide a point of contact for end users to receive a high level of support and maintenance within the organization’s desktop computing environment. This includes supporting M365, software application support as well as installing, diagnosing, repairing, maintaining and upgrading all PC hardware, network and voice equipment to ensure optimal performance. The person will also troubleshoot problem areas (in person, by telephone, or via email) in a timely and accurate fashion and provide end-user assistance where required.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Provide first- and second-level technical support to employees through phone, email, chat, and in-person assistance.
  • Diagnose, troubleshoot, and resolve hardware, software, operating system, and connectivity issues.
  • Install, configure, maintain, and troubleshoot computers, laptops, monitors, printers, mobile devices, and other IT equipment.
  • Create, configure, and manage user accounts, passwords, permissions, and access to applications and systems.
  • Support Microsoft Windows, Microsoft 365, collaboration tools, and other business applications.
  • Assist with network connectivity, Wi‑Fi, VPN, printers, and other infrastructure-related issues.
  • Manage and document support requests using a ticketing/help desk system.
  • Escalate complex technical issues to appropriate IT personnel or vendors when necessary.
  • Maintain accurate documentation of IT procedures, configurations, inventory, and troubleshooting solutions.
  • Assist with software deployments, system upgrades, hardware refreshes, and IT projects.
  • Monitor and follow established cybersecurity, data protection, access control, and IT security policies.
  • Provide user training and guidance on technology, applications, cybersecurity awareness, and best practices.
  • Assist with IT asset management, including inventory, deployment, maintenance, and retirement of equipment.
  • Participate in backup, disaster recovery, and business continuity activities as assigned.
  • Stay current with emerging technologies and recommend improvements that enhance productivity, reliability, and security.
  • Perform other IT-related duties as assigned.
QUALIFICATIONS

Education: Certificate or Associate’s Degree in Computer Science, Bachelor’s or equivalent in Computer Science, Information Systems or related field preferred.

Required Experience:

  • Associate deg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related field, or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• 2+ years of experience providing technical support in a professional environment.
  • Strong knowledge of Windows operating systems, Microsoft 365, common business applications, and computer hardware.
  • Working knowledge of networking concepts, including T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, Wi‑Fi, and VPN.
  • Experience with help desk/ticketing systems and remote support tools.
  • Strong troubleshooting,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ong customer service skills and the ability to work effectively with users of varying technical abilities.
  • Ability to prioritize multiple requests and manage time effectively.
